## Firmware Channel Release — Quickfen Devices

New folks: the Quickfen stable channel only accepts signed firmware images. Build with `qfn build --release`, then sign before pushing to the channel. Devices verify on boot; a bad signature bricks nothing but blocks the update. Always confirm the channel manifest updated before announcing. Sign every image with the channel deploy key that follows.

rollout seal: bky4_DFM9

**Postmortem timeline — 14:32**

At 14:32 we realized the Glimmerkit component library had published 5.0.0 under the 4.x dist-tag, so everyone pinned to "latest-stable" silently pulled breaking changes. Plugin authors: this is why your modals lost their close buttons. We yanked the release at 14:40 and re-tagged. The yanked artifact can be identified by the build token below.

pipeline stamp: htk4_ae36

## Deploying the Gatewick Proctor Queue

Deploys are pretty painless: push to main, wait for the pipeline, then watch the queue drain dashboard for five minutes. If candidates pile up mid-exam, roll back first and ask questions later — the queue replays safely. Everything the workers care about lives in one config block, shown here for reference.

settings of bafof-yagef:
JOROX_PIN=8740
JOROX_TENANT=pelox
JOROX_METRICS_HOST=metrics.jorox.qorvelworks.internal
JOROX_SEAL=seal_c78f63c1
JOROX_STANDBY_TEAM=norax